مشکل: بعد از نصب ویستا دیگه xp بوت نمیشه!
راه حل
رفع این مشکل یکمی دردسر داره (البته نه برای حرفه ای ها)
من خودم یکی دو ساعت گشتم تا این راه حل رو پیدا کردم. نمیدونم شاید راه حل ساده تری هم باشه. اما فعلا من همین یه راه رو بلدم که میخوام بهتون یاد بدم
مرحله 1
ابتدا به 3 تا فایل
boot.ini
NTDETECT.COM
ntldr
نیاز داریم. ممکنه بعضی از دوستان(مثل من) ویستل رو روی پارتیشن اولیه نصب کرده باشن و الان به این 3 تا فایل دسترسی نداشته باشن.
این فایل ها رو میتونید از لینک زیر بگیرین.
[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]
نکته:
فایل boot.ini را باید ویرایش کنید. این فایل رو با نوت پد باز کنید. متن داخلیش اینه
[boot loader]
timeout=10
default=multi(0)disk(0)rdisk(0)partition(2)\WINDOWS
[operating systems]
multi(0)disk(0)rdisk(0)partition(2)\WINDOWS="Microsoft Windows XP Professional"
اگه ویندوز xp داخل درایو C نصبه اون 2 تا عددی که با رنگ آبی مشخص شده رو به 1 تغییر بدید. اگه روی D نصبه همون 2 باید باشه. اگه روی E نصبه بکنیدش 3...
خوب. حالا این 3 فایل رو کپی کنید داخل C
مرحله 2
از آدرس زیر Command Prompt رو اجرا کنید
Start/ All Programs/ Accessories/ Rigth Click on Command Prompt/ Run as administrator
4 دستور زیر رو به ترتیپ در خط فرمان کپی کنید و دکمه اینتر رو فشار دهید
bcdedit /create {legacy} /d “Windows_XP”
bcdedit /set {legacy} device boot
bcdedit /set {legacy} path \ntldr
bcdedit /displayorder {legacy} /addlast
بعد از ریست کردن کامپیوتر میتوانید ویندوز Xp یا ویستا را جهت بوت شدن انتخاب کنید